Lake Michigan offers a variety of recreational opportunities, including swimming, boating, fishing, and kayaking. Its sandy beaches provide ideal spots for sunbathing and picnicking, while the surrounding parks and trails are perfect for hiking and biking. The lake is also popular for water sports like jet skiing and paddleboarding. Additionally, fishing enthusiasts can enjoy both freshwater fishing and charter fishing excursions.
Chicago, Green Bay, and Milwaukee are settlements located on the shores of Lake Michigan. This Great Lake is bordered by four U.S. states: Illinois, Indiana, Wisconsin, and Michigan. It is the only Great Lake located entirely within the United States. Lake Michigan is known for its recreational opportunities and scenic beauty.
Michigan is bordered by four of the five Great Lakes: Lake Superior to the north, Lake Michigan to the west, Lake Huron to the east, and Lake Erie to the southeast. These lakes contribute significantly to Michigan's geography, economy, and recreational opportunities. The state's unique position as a peninsula allows for extensive waterfront access and activities related to these lakes.
